a checklist for end of tenancy cleaning

Do you fancy requesting professionals to take over the end of tenancy cleaning , or would you like to do everything yourself? Regardless of your decision, do peruse the checklist outlined below. Additionally, obtain a final inspection checklist from your landlord. It should prove useful for comparison purposes. Walls Look for pencil or pen marks, patches of dirt, scuffs, etc. If the wall paint is not washable in nature, just get some emulsion of the same colour and cover up the marks and patches. Similarly, if you have excessive fondness for hanging up decorations and pictures, you may need wall filler putty to plug the nail holes. When through, paint over the filled holes. Bleach is an excellent cleaning agent for removing moulds. Windows and Blinds/Curtains Vinegar and alcohol are best for keeping windows clean.
